While Mike Shinoda wrote most of the lyrics, melodies, and even the drum parts—a rarity for him—the song was a true band effort. Chester Bennington and guitarist Brad Delson noted a significant folk influence during the writing process, with the band drawing inspiration from collections like "The Anthology Of American Folk Music".
Though it was never released as a single, the song reached a wider audience in 2014, when it was featured as the end-credit track for the action film Need for Speed , starring Aaron Paul. A notable remix by Rad Omen, featuring rapper Bun B, was also included on the band's Recharged remix album in 2013, blending genres like house and trap.

The title itself, “Roads Untraveled,” immediately evokes the famous Robert Frost poem The Road Not Taken , suggesting themes of regret, choice, and moving forward. The lyrics are characterized by a duality of pain and hope. While the opening verses dive into the “worst kind of pain” and heartbreak, the song ultimately transcends despair. While its themes of moving on are universal, the song has deeply personal origins. Shinoda revealed at a 2018 concert that the song was originally written about a close friend's broken engagement. Tragically, after Chester Bennington's passing in 2017, the lyrics took on a new, profound meaning for Shinoda, representing his own grief and the need to move forward.
